Collins Aerospace, an RTX company, is a leader in technologically advanced and intelligent solutions for the global aerospace and defense industry. Collins Aerospace has the capabilities, comprehensive portfolio, and expertise to solve customers’ toughest challenges and to meet the demands of a rapidly evolving global market.

This position is for an experienced professional in Program Management (Value Stream Leader) who will lead a key new program for the ejection seating business. The Senior Value Stream Leader, who works independently as the primary customer interface, who works independently, leads large programs, analyzes data, recommends resolutions for program problems, manages vendors, maintains progress reports, and participates in contract negotiation.

What You Will Do

  • Responsible for Profit and Loss of large program value stream

  • Leads risk and opportunity management for the program

  • Participates in the negotiation of contracts and contractual changes, including coordinating preparation of proposals, business plans, proposal work statements, operational budgets, specifications, and financial conditions of contracts to ensure legal compliance and to protect the organization’s interests

  • Leads large programs to support the development of program plans, schedules, and budgets for programs under his/her responsibility

  • Establishes key performance indicators and directs work to achieve these targets

  • Analyzes data and monitors programs to ensure adherence to cost, schedule and technical specifications

  • Maintains and presents plans and progress reports relating to business aspects of the program(s) to Senior Leadership

  • Implements continuous improvement initiatives to optimize efficiency and quality, specifically utilizing CORE (Customer Oriented Results and Excellence), lean, or six sigma methodology

  • Identifies and addresses program problems and recommends resolutions to ensure the successful completion of programs Leads program work with the various functional organizations to ensure alignment with the customer program objectives

  • Manages vendors, when necessary, to support the program

  • Directs all program phases from inception through completion Interfaces with customers for project requirements to ensure successful completion

  • Manages the contract lifecycle, cost, schedule and performance of company programs or subsystems of major programs

Qualifications You Must Have

  • Typically requires a University Degree and minimum 10 years prior relevant experience or an Advanced Degree in a related field and minimum 7 years of experience

Qualifications We Prefer

  • PMP Certification Preferred

  • EVMS Experience Preferred
